This is more of a system wide glitch. It has worked in other games and might still work on the system itself. This involves editing the system clock, yes the little clock on your task bar. This glitch worked on Warcraft (original) and Worms 3D (xD) that Ive tested. And does also work on FFXI.
As I said this is very glitchy! This can cause your computer to go unstable! As well as get you stuck in walls or other random objects on FFXI.
Also I take no responsibility to what you do with this exploit / cheat. What you do is your actions, and your responsible for them.
Ok now onto the glitch. It is best to be using the window mode, unless you are able to Alt + Tab out of the game (using another program) or what ever.
Now double click your system clock in the bottom right corner (if you have your start bar on the default position..) And it will open the Set Time / Date properties.
Now, set your clock to say any time between:
12:12:12: to 1:00:12 (AM/PM doesnt matter)
Then click Apply. After you click apply change the time again. This time, change it to:
1:30:20
Then, click back onto the game window, if nothing happens right away give it a moment. Soon enough, your entire game should speed up really fast. As I said, this is very unstable and can get you banned perminatly from the game. Now, if it didnt work for you try again.
I used 12:12:12 when I changed the time.
Also, with this glitch, you can make your game go really slow as well. I want to add that this glitch can activate itself when ever it wants after you do it once, unless you restart your computer, or change the time completely. Meaning that if it stops, it can start up again randomly. So if your speeding to get to somewhere earlier then everyone else, then I would say restart your computer after you get there. AS I said, its buggy!
Basic run down:
- Open System Timer Properties
- Change time to 12:12:12
- Click Apply
- Change time to 1:30:20
- Click Apply
- Go back into the game and speed your little heart out.
